Getting latest file from ftp

Hi,

i have multile JAMA01.DAT.* files in my ftp.

how can i get the latest file in from the ftp by executing the script Smilie?

You could get them all and sort all that out locally or something like this quick hack (very dependent on output of LIST command)

Code:
#!/usr/bin/perl                                                                                                              

use strict;
#use Data::Dumper;                                                                                                           
use Net::FTP;
use Date::Parse;

my $site  = 'localhost';
my $user  = 'anonymous';
my $pass  = 'nobody@localhost.com';
my $path  = '/';
my $regex = '/\s+JAMA01\.DAT.*$/';
my $debug = 0;

my $ftp = Net::FTP->new($site, Debug => $debug)
    or die "Cannot connect to some.host.name: $@";

$ftp->login($user, $pass)
    or die "Cannot login ", $ftp->message;

$ftp->cwd($path)
    or die "Cannot change working directory ", $ftp->message;

my (@items) = $ftp->dir()
    or die "Cannot list directory ", $ftp->message;

my %files;
my $new_file;
my $new_ts=0;

for my $item (@items)
{
    next unless($item =~ m/^-/); # only real files                                                                           
    next unless(grep($regex, $item));

    my $ts;
    my $file;

    $item =~ m/\s+(\w+\s+\d+\s+\d+:\d+)\s+(.*)$/;
    $ts   = $1;
    $file = $2;

    if($ts)
    {
        $ts = str2time($ts);
    }
    else
    {
        warn("could not parse date on line:\n$item\n");
        next;
    }
    $files{$file}=$ts;
    $new_file = $ts > $new_ts ? $file : $new_file;
    $new_ts   = $ts > $new_ts ? $ts : $new_ts;
}

$ftp->get($new_file)
    or die "get failed ", $ftp->message;
$ftp->quit;
